Each player should fulfill his dream with passion and focus but must have ‘Will To Do’: Rana Sodhi
Rana Sodhi inaugurates Punjab State Games for Boys (Under-18) at SBS Stadium in Ferozepur
Ferozepur, October 20, 2019: Rana Gurmit Singh Sodhi, Cabinet Minister for Sports and Youth Services, Punjab today inaugurated the three days Punjab State Games for Boys (Under-18) – dedicated to Guru Nanak’s 550th Parkash Utsav, at SBS Stadium in Ferozepur.
Addressing a gathering of around 4,000 participants at the inaugural ceremony, Rana Sodhi said, Each player should fulfill his dream with passion and focus but must have ‘Will To Do’. He also administered the pledge to have a sense of discipline towards the games.
He said, “The Punjab government, led by Capt Amarinder Singh, was making every effort to encourage the youth towards sports so that the youth could get rid of disease like drug addiction. He said that now any player who wins Gold Medal will be given Government job at Rs 1 crore and the player who wins Silver Medal will be given Government job at Rs 75 lakh. Similarly, the winner of the Brown Medal (Bronze Medal) will be given 50 lakhs besides free training”.
On this occasion, march past, torch ceremony followed by the cultural program were also presented by the children.
He further said that Punjab Government has reserved 3% of the jobs for sports quota and Maharaja Bhupinder Singh University is being set up in Patiala with all the facilities available for the players including coaching.
He said that at the cost of Rs 6 crore at the back of the stadium, Astroturf Hockey International Stadium is likely to be completed shortly for which the foundation stone was laid and existing swimming pool in Ferozepur would also be modernized soon.
